Portrait Photography   

Join Gary McCutcheon photographer extraordinaire, and learn the foundational skills required for taking Portrait photographs in a variety of situations. In this class, you will learn about proper lighting techniques for indoor and outdoor portraits, head and shoulder shots, 3/4 length photos, as well as full length portraits. You will also learn to pose your subject(s), challenge your creativity using natural light, continuous and flash lightning and reflectors. Ultimately, you will build skills that will enable you to take photographs that look like professional portraits. Handouts will be provided.

Equipment Needed:

  1. Fully adjustable Digital Camera, DSLR or Mirrorless
  2. Flash (if available)
  3. Fully charged batteries for your camera and flash
  4. Notebook pen or pencil
